At the present time, each individual piece is being carefully
categorized and preserved in protective coverings; about 30,000
titles now completed, computer databased, as well as stored on disk. This is being done in southern Oregon, U.S.A.
The greatest percentage of this collection is printed
sheet music acquired and held over a sixty year period with some pieces
dating as old as the early 1800's.
Most impressive is the
Variety of Genre as well as the value as related to such reference
books as Sheet Music Reference by Anna Marie Guiheen and
Marie-Reine A. Pafik (2nd Edition-Schroder Publishing 1995).
This collection boasts of containing no less than 50% of the
titles found in 'that' reference book which reveals most of them to be worth several dollars each.
A substantial amount are
worth far more; up to $45 per title in some instances.
